The master program Strategy, Innovation, and Management Control (organizational leadership) is a four-semester program and requires 120 ECTS points to obtain a degree. Graduates are awarded a Master of Science (WU) degree, which is abbreviated as an MSc (WU). (Optional double degree in cooperation with selected partner schools.

You're interested in a career as an executive or in founding your own start-up? Our top-ranked SIMC program prepares you for your role as a future business leader. It combines theory and practice with a strong international focus and helps you to develop the social skills you need to succeed. SIMC bridges the gap between the qualitative aspects of management (strategy and innovation) and the quantitative aspects (management control and financial management).

Application and admission

Every year, the rolling admissions for our English-taught master’s programs open on September, 1st for the start of the following year. We have three priority deadlines, and we advise international students to apply as early as possible so that they can arrange their Visa and language tests.

  • Priority deadline I: October, 8th (Results are expected to be available by mid-December)
  • Priority deadline II: January, 8th (Results are expected to be available by the end of March)
  • Priority deadline III: March, 8th (Results are expected to be available by mid-June)

Admission Requirements

Various specific requirements apply to each program, these must be demonstrated during the application process, as well as your aptitude for the program. Requirements include amongst others:

  • completion of a relevant degree program
  • examinations in relevant areas, e.g. Business, Economics, Mathematics, etc.
  • proof of aptitude, e.g. GMAT, letter of recommendation, etc.
  • excellent proficiency in English
